The real answer, is almost anything works for those cats from stink
baits to cut bait,, Shrimp is a great bait for those type cats, shell
them first. Hot dogs work much better than baloney, but I have seen
people use baloney, rolled into a bait that will fit in their mouths
Chicken liver is an awesome bait, (never frozen fresh liver is better
than frozen), wrap about 10 inches of sewing thread around the baited
hook (no knot needed) and it will stay on the hook when casting,, and
greatly reduce most of the bait lost when they bite.
Don't use a whole piece of liver, 1/4 piece is plenty for any size cat,
I caught a 22 lber on a piece the size of your thumb nail
Also cats don't know what a barb is, no fish does, they don't even know
what a hook is, and they also don't know what a bite looks like or care
if another fish has been feeding on their meal
